Lela Karayanni: the Fragrance of a Heroine 2005 Directed by Vassilis Loules Συναντήσεις με την Μητέρα μου Λέλα Καραγιάννη

The Bouboulina of the Greek resistance

Moments from the action and personality of Lela Karagianni, the legendary ""Bouboulina"" of the Resistance, are portrayed through the tender, personal perspective of her son, Giorgos. Wanted during the German Occupation, the young man secretly met with his mother, Lela, for the needs of the struggle. Yet, even under those harsh conditions, he had the chance to experience the tenderness and affection of the heroine, who never ceased to be a mother. Illegal film footage captures rare images of Occupied Athens, while Giorgos’ fragmented memories still carry something of ""Violetta di Parma,"" Lela Karagianni's favorite perfume.
